Why is the trust score of jobchezsoi.com very low?
The website jobchezsoi.com claims to offer work-from-home opportunities as a chat operator, with the promise of high earnings. However, several red flags indicate that this might be a scam:
1. Lack of Detailed Information: The website provides very limited information about the company, the nature of the work, or the specific responsibilities of the job. Legitimate job postings usually offer detailed descriptions.
2. Unrealistic Earning Claims: The promise of earning an average of 300€ per week for a chat-based job, with potential for much higher earnings, is highly unrealistic for this type of work.
3. Identity Verification: Requiring a recent ID card for verification is unusual for a chat operator position and could be a way to collect personal information for fraudulent purposes.
4. No CV Required: Legitimate employers typically request a CV or resume as part of the application process. The absence of this requirement is unusual.
5. Age Verification: While it’s common for employers to verify that applicants are of legal working age, the emphasis on this point and the need to prove age during the application process is unusual.
6. Payment Methods: The mention of payments through an unspecified online payment provider and the requirement to reach a certain payment threshold before receiving earnings are common in scam job offers.
7. Lack of Company Information: The website provides no verifiable information about the company, such as its registration, physical address, or contact details beyond an email address.
8. Adult Content Disclaimer: The mention of “content for adults” and the nature of the chat-based work could be a red flag, especially if it’s not clearly and professionally explained.
9. Vague Job Description: The description of the work as responding to informal messages on an adult-themed messaging network is vague and lacks specific details about the job.
10. Independent Contractor Status: While it’s not uncommon for chat operators to work as independent contractors, the emphasis on this point, without clear details about the working relationship, is suspicious.
11. High Earning Claims: The mention of potential earnings of up to 3000€ per month for experienced operators is highly exaggerated for this type of work.
12. Weekly Payments: While legitimate employers may pay weekly, the emphasis on this point, especially with conditions attached, can be a tactic used in scam job offers.
Given these red flags, it’s advisable to approach this website with caution and to thoroughly research and verify the legitimacy of the job offer before providing any personal information or engaging in the application process.”
